Do you do reworks or coverups?
Yes, I do accept reworks and coverups on a case-by-case basis, as long as I feel that I can execute the tattoo well. Keep in mind with a coverup that you will need to be flexible and open with the design, and that the covering design will likely be 2x - 3x larger than the original tattoo. If you are not okay with me having creative freedom, then I likely will not accept the project.

When can I go swimming?
Please wait at least 3 weeks after getting tattooed to swim or submerge your tattoo in water. If you are getting tattooed during warmer weather, please plan accordingly.
